Nebula Grey Pearl is also called Mercury Grey Metallic and is/was used on a number of Toyota vehicles, such as the Toyota Corolla.

Atomic Silver Metallic is also Sonic Titanium Metallic. used on the Toyota Sequoia.and Highlander, among others.

So neither of your color choice options will be unique to the LX model Lexus, or even to Lexus, and you will see plenty of other Lexus and Toyotas painted these colors. I learned about this while buying paint for some work of my Nebula Grey LX. I also have a Nebula Grey ISC.

If you want to blend in conservatively, in either color you will have a lot of company. A selling point for a lighter color has always been the idea that it reflects more sunlight and the interior stays cooler.

My RX was NGP and my first GS was AS.

Both are fantastic colors. NGP is easy to care for, but AS showed less dirt and swirl marks. I prefer AS, but I will admit that I was always worried about whether a body shop could match it should an accident occur. There are some horror stories here on CL about that. My RX did get hit, so we had to deal with NGP, but my body shop had no issue with matching it.
